Mabton High School Assistant Track & Field Coach

Primary Function: 
A High School Assistant Track & Field Coach has the responsibility to help students develop skills and knowledge
with the districts athletic handbook and goals that will contribute to the students’ development as mature, able and
responsible adults. Assistant Track & Field Coaches are responsible for maintaining a safe environment on and off
campus. They are responsible for maintaining record of students and equipment. To assist the Head Coach in all
duties that apply while teaching the sport of Track & Field.
Directly Responsible To: Athletic Director; Vice Principal; Principal
Description of Responsibilities:   
1. Serve as a positive role model to the players and parents
2. Teach Track & Field techniques, playing rules, strategies and playing tactics
3. Condition athletes appropriately for activities requiring endurance, strength and agility
4. Preside over team activities including all scheduled team practices and games
5. Teach sportsmanship, cooperation, work ethic and responsibility to one’s team
6. Monitor players' personal conduct during games
7. Manage equipment and playing facilities in a responsible manner
8. Performs related duties as required
9. Hold a valid first aid/CPR/AED card to comply with Mabton School District policy and procedures.
10. Demonstrated working knowledge of the above-mentioned sport
11. Demonstrated interest in and ability to work well with multicultural High School students,
staff and community
12. Promote the sport, within WIAA guidelines and complete all required WIAA Coaches Clinics.
13. Inventory, selection, care, maintenance of equipment and play surfaces
14. Perform such other related duties as may be assigned by the athletic director, vice principal or principal.
15. Cultural Competency; ability to effectively work with diverse populations
Other Functions:
1. Follow oral and written instructions
2. Work cooperatively with other
3. Be neat, orderly and honest
4. Work weekdays, practice after school
5. Interpret policies and procedures
6. Travel with teams for matches during the week
7. Work with people of all ages
8. On a continuous basis, work indoors; intermittently travel to various off-site locations; may be exposed to dust,
noise, hard surfaces, and may be exposed to varying temperature conditions while performing work
Preferred Qualifications:
1. Ability to work well with children of various ages; basic knowledge of Track & Field
2. Willingness to learn and follow District rules and guidelines regarding youth sports
3. Prior coaching experience is helpful, but not required
4. Education/experience: Any combination of education and experience that would likely provide the required
knowledge and skills is qualifying
5. Previous experience in coaching children in some type of sport
6. Formal or informal education or training which ensures the ability to read and write at a level necessary for
successful coaching performance
Minimum Qualifications: 
1. Completion of high school diploma or GED
2. Must be 18 years of age or older
3. Complete Washington State Patrol Criminal History background check

WORKING ENVIRONMENT:
MENTAL DEMANDS
Required to deal with a wide range of student, staff and public behaviors and needs in a positive and service-oriented
manner. May occasionally deal with distraught or difficult students or parents.
PHYSICAL DEMANDS
Amount of standing, sitting, walking, bending, and twisting will vary depending on the age of students and classroom
assignments. Physical capabilities also require lifting and carrying (no more than 50 lbs.) pushing and/or pulling,
stooping, kneeling, crouching, crawling, twisting, and significant finger dexterity. Generally, the job requires
approximately 35% sitting, 35% walking, and 30% standing. Maintaining good hygiene is essential.
